Chatham Maritime

Client: Countryside Properties and SEEDA

This project is being developed on the former Royal Naval Base at St Mary’s Island, Chatham. It comprises a variety of housing types set within a mixed-use scheme. The work is being promoted by SEEDA who continue to set high standards of environmental performance.

All the buildings are assessed using the BREEAM [Building Research Establishment Environmental Assessment] method that includes EcoHomes and BREEAM for offices.

Achievements

  • Successfully achieved EcoHomes Excellent or Very Good standards on all 13 phases.
  • 10% renewable energy achieved on phases 7 and 8.
  • Cost effective solutions for Code Level 4.
